The Origins of Jueteng

Jueteng, pronounced "hwe-teng," traces its roots back to the Spanish colonial period in the Philippines. Adapted from Chinese games of chance, it involves players betting on a combination of numbers. Traditionally, bets are placed on two numbers ranging from 1 to 37, drawn randomly using two sets of wooden balls. Despite its illicit status, Jueteng thrives due to its simplicity and the low cost of entry, making it accessible to a wide range of participants.

Jueteng and Its Social Influence

The game's entrenchment in local communities has profound implications. For many, Jueteng offers a sense of hope and anticipation, particularly in economically disadvantaged regions where opportunities for financial gain are limited. The low stakes encourage widespread participation, creating a shared pastime that fosters community connections.

However, the prevalence of Jueteng raises concerns about its impact on societal norms and values. Critics argue that it perpetuates a cycle of poverty and opportunism, as individuals become reliant on the unlikely prospect of winning. Furthermore, the illegal nature of Jueteng means that it often operates within a web of corruption and payoffs, further entrenching informal economies and undermining governance.
